What is Ulesfia?
Ulesfia lotion is an anti-parasite medication.
Ulesfia lotion is used to treat head lice in people between 6 months of age and 60 years old.
Ulesfia is for treating head lice only. It will not treat lice on other body areas.
Warnings
Ulesfia lotion is used to treat head lice in people between the ages of 6 months and 60 years old. This medicine will not treat lice on other body areas.
Do not use Ulesfia on a child or infant younger than 6 months old.
If Ulesfia lotion gets in your eyes or on your skin, rinse with water. Call your doctor at once if you have severe stinging, itching, or irritation of the eyes or skin after rinsing.
Avoid head to head contact with others. Avoid sharing hair brushes, combs, hair accessories, hats, scarves, and pillows. Lice infections are highly contagious.

Ulesfia lotion contains an ingredient that can cause serious side effects or death in very young or premature babies.
Do not use Ulesfia lotion on an infant younger than 6 months old, and tell your healthcare provider if your baby was born prematurely.
Tell your doctor if you are pregnant or breastfeeding.
You should not breastfeed while using Ulesfia.
How should I use Ulesfia?
Use Ulesfia lotion exactly as prescribed by your doctor. Follow all directions on your prescription label and read all medication guides or instruction sheets.
Do not allow a young child to use this medicine without help from an adult.
Do not take Ulesfia by mouth. It is for use only on the hair and scalp.
Read and carefully follow any Instructions for Use provided with your medicine. Ask your doctor or pharmacist if you do not understand these instructions.
Wash your hands with soap and water after applying this medicine.
Do not wet your hair or scalp before applying Ulesfia lotion. Apply enough lotion to completely soak your scalp and hair and massage in thoroughly.
Leave the lotion on for 10 minutes, keeping your eyes closed and covered with a towel during this time. Then rinse out thoroughly with water. Use a fine-tooth nit comb to remove lice eggs from the hair, rinsing the comb often during use. Place removed nits into a sealed plastic bag and throw it into the trash to prevent re-infestation.
